Introduction
[1] This is an appeal by the Respondent against the decision of this Court in allowing the Appellant's appeal against both conviction and sentence imposed by the learned Sessions Court Judge of Alor Setar on the Appellant for two Charges under the Dangerous Drugs Act 1952 [Act 234] (" DDA "), that are under s 12(2) of which is punishable under s 39A(1) of the same Act and under s 15(1)(a) of , respectively.
[2] The Respondent is the Public Prosecutor and the Appellant is the Accused in the Court below. In this Judgment, parties will be referred to as they were in the Sessions Court.
[3] For the First Charge, the Accused had been sentenced to 36 months imprisonment from the date of conviction (ie 8 January 2020) and four strokes, and for the Second Charge, 12 months imprisonment from the date of conviction and two years police supervision. Both imprisonment sentences are to run concurrently. Upon the Accused's application, the trial Court had granted stay of execution pending appeal and set bail at RM20,000.00.
